Output 2868d7d80f8a251fd37b623cbeb98e49320f016b75496a7eb166f757363a66d8:1

value
2064098
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45a9f92aaec984850ba5976c524724c1321a1492 OP_EQUALVERIFY OP_CHECKSIG
address
17MMFBwxCWn6nFwNVKR9GGFqw4RJDTRDcS
transaction
2868d7d80f8a251fd37b623cbeb98e49320f016b75496a7eb166f757363a66d8
spent
true